Объявление форума |
Если пользуетесь личными сообщениями и получили по электронной почте оповещение о новом письме, не отвечайте, пожалуйста, почтой. Зайдите на форум и ответьте отправителю через ЛС. |
Полигон-2 » IBM PC-совместимое. До 2000 года включительно » Разъёмы IDE на звуковых картах |
<<Назад Вперед>> | Страницы: 1 2 * 3 4 | Печать |
Forza3dfx
Advanced Member
Всего сообщений: 493 Рейтинг пользователя: 0 Ссылка Дата регистрации на форуме: 1 мар. 2015 |
Если мне нужна мультизагрузка на винте, я создаю 2 (или 3, если планируется три разных оси) первичных раздела в таблице разделов и один расширенный, в котором все остальные логические диски данных (обычно делаю еще 3 - для игр, для библио и мультимедиа, для инсталляторов и утилит), а потом использую мини-загрузчик собственного написания на асм-е длиной в 1 сектор (512 байт) для выбора активного первичного раздела. При инсталляции в MBR мини-загрузчик тестирует таблицу разделов на предмет наличия первичных загрузочных разделов, понимает несколько вариантов FAT/FAT32, а также NTFS и Linux разделы. При загрузке выдает меню - с какого из найденных первичных разделов грузиться. Остальные первичные разделы по всем правилам делает скрытыми. Также имеет возможность деинсталляции по необходимости. Вот и пользуюсь ей уже 20 лет))), первая версия от 1995 года была. |
Rio444
Гость
Откуда: Ростов-на-Дону Всего сообщений: 8632 Рейтинг пользователя: 0 Ссылка Дата регистрации на форуме: 14 сен. 2014 |
Forza3dfx написал: Вы предлагаете автору темы тоже написать свой загрузчик? |
alecv
Advanced Member
Откуда: Санкт-Петербург Всего сообщений: 5545 Рейтинг пользователя: 0 Ссылка Дата регистрации на форуме: 5 окт. 2004 |
Можно поставить XT IDE Universal BIOS только сказать ему, что контроллер - обычный IDE ISA-16 но на нестандартном I/O адресе и прерывании и получить нормально работающий и загрузочный диск. |
Arix
Advanced Member
Откуда: Саратов Всего сообщений: 1399 Рейтинг пользователя: 0 Ссылка Дата регистрации на форуме: 18 июля 2015 |
Ну вот, я наконец-то решил заняться этим всерьёз. Итак, звуковая карта ESS1868F. Я запускаю утилиту конфигурации. У меня там в разделе IDE есть такой список: PORT --------- INT# [Disable]------ [Disable] 170H --------- INT11 1E8H --------- INT11 168H --------- INT9 Я пробовал несколько вариантов, сидюк не определяется. При загрузке ДОСа первым появляется сообщение: ESS IDE CD-ROM controller ( ES1868 ) enable program V4.3 Потом идёт загрузка драйвера CD-ROM'a (дубовый - OAKCDROM). Комп долго думает, потом пишет "No drives found, aborting installation". Что интересно, если прицепить вместо сидюка винт, то данное сообщение появляется сразу, без всяких раздумий. То есть, драйвер краем глаза видит сидюк, раз так долго думает? Может, нужен другой драйвер CD? А MSCDEX нужен? |
uav1606
Advanced Member
Откуда: Енакиево Всего сообщений: 4373 Рейтинг пользователя: 0 Ссылка Дата регистрации на форуме: 16 янв. 2008 |
Профиль | Сообщить модератору
NEW! Сообщение отправлено: 23 июня 2016 20:31 Сообщение отредактировано: 23 июня 2016 20:37
Arix написал: Безусловно, но это уже в autoexec.bat, после нормальной загрузки драйвера CD-ROM. А MSCDEX нужен? Попробуйте просто другой драйвер, в VIDE-CDD.SYS точно можно принудительно задать порт и прерывание в параметрах. Т.е. у Вас должно быть что-то вроде такого: Config.sys: DEVICE=ES1868.COM /A:168 /I:A DEVICE=VIDE-CDD.SYS /D:MSCD001 /P:168,10 Autoexec.bat: MSCDEX /D:MSCD001 /V ( "/A:168 /I:A" - порт 168, затем прерывание в шестнадцатеричном виде, т.е. A hex = 10 dec в данном случае, а "/P:168,10" - порт и прерывание, на этот раз в десятичном виде.) |
Arix
Advanced Member
Откуда: Саратов Всего сообщений: 1399 Рейтинг пользователя: 0 Ссылка Дата регистрации на форуме: 18 июля 2015 |
uav1606 написал: Попробовал. Вроде как, сидюк обнаруживается, его буква появляется, но... Долго грузится MSCDEX, но ошибок не выдает. Зайти на диск невозможно - DOS Navigator долго раздумывает, выдает ошибку чтения, потом от этого сообщения никак не избавишься, оно вылезает несколько раз. Из CD-проигрывателя дисковод не управляется, музыкальные диски тоже не видятся. Ну и, после любой попытки доступа к сидюку компьютер сильно тормозит до перезагрузки. Попробуйте просто другой драйвер, в VIDE-CDD.SYS |
uav1606
Advanced Member
Откуда: Енакиево Всего сообщений: 4373 Рейтинг пользователя: 0 Ссылка Дата регистрации на форуме: 16 янв. 2008 |
Профиль | Сообщить модератору
NEW! Сообщение отправлено: 23 июня 2016 22:46 Сообщение отредактировано: 23 июня 2016 22:49
А какие параметры - порт и прерывание - ставили? Может, у Вас 10-е вообще чем-то занято? Попробуйте в настройках вместо него то же 9-е везде поставить (или 11-е, оно же B). И порт можно на что-нибудь поменять. Как у Вас сейчас вообще конфигурация в config.sys и autoexec.bat выглядит? Можно ещё какой-нибудь UDVD.SYS попробовать... Что за CD, кстати, используется, точно рабочий? Перемычки Master/Slave стоят правильно и, может, шлейф заменой проверить? |
Arix
Advanced Member
Откуда: Саратов Всего сообщений: 1399 Рейтинг пользователя: 0 Ссылка Дата регистрации на форуме: 18 июля 2015 |
Профиль | Сообщить модератору
NEW! Сообщение отправлено: 23 июня 2016 23:17 Сообщение отредактировано: 24 июня 2016 0:12
uav1606 написал: порт 168 прерывание 9 А какие параметры - порт и прерывание - ставили? 170 - 11. Мне не очень понятно следующее: uav1606 написал: /P:168,10 - здесь 168 - шестнадцатеричное или тоже десятичное? ( "/A:168 /I:A" - порт 168, затем прерывание в шестнадцатеричном виде, т.е. A hex = 10 dec в данном случае, а "/P:168,10" - порт и прерывание, на этот раз в десятичном виде.) uav1606 написал: СD рабочий, уже два шлейфа пробовал. А как должна стоять перемычка на сидюке - master или slave? Хотя, я пробовал и так и эдак. Что за CD, кстати, используется, точно рабочий? Перемычки Master/Slave стоят правильно и, может, шлейф заменой проверить? |
uav1606
Advanced Member
Откуда: Енакиево Всего сообщений: 4373 Рейтинг пользователя: 0 Ссылка Дата регистрации на форуме: 16 янв. 2008 |
Профиль | Сообщить модератору
NEW! Сообщение отправлено: 23 июня 2016 23:42 Сообщение отредактировано: 24 июня 2016 0:04
Arix написал: Master. А как должна стоять перемычка на сидюке - master или slave? Arix написал: А почему 198, а не 168? порт 198 прерывание 9 Arix написал: 168 (и вообще номер порта) - шестнадцатеричное везде. 168 - шестнадцатеричное или тоже десятичное? Можете попробовать такие комбинации: DEVICE=ES1868.COM /A:168 /I:A DEVICE=VIDE-CDD.SYS /D:MSCD001 /P:168,10 DEVICE=ES1868.COM /A:168 /I:B DEVICE=VIDE-CDD.SYS /D:MSCD001 /P:168,11 DEVICE=ES1868.COM /A:168 /I:9 DEVICE=VIDE-CDD.SYS /D:MSCD001 /P:168,9 DEVICE=ES1868.COM /A:170 /I:A DEVICE=VIDE-CDD.SYS /D:MSCD001 /P:170,10 DEVICE=ES1868.COM /A:170 /I:B DEVICE=VIDE-CDD.SYS /D:MSCD001 /P:170,11 DEVICE=ES1868.COM /A:170 /I:9 DEVICE=VIDE-CDD.SYS /D:MSCD001 /P:170,9 DEVICE=ES1868.COM /A:170 /I:F DEVICE=VIDE-CDD.SYS /D:MSCD001 /P:170,15 Я так понял, канал (разъём) IDE на этом компьютере один? Не считая звуковушки? |
Arix
Advanced Member
Откуда: Саратов Всего сообщений: 1399 Рейтинг пользователя: 0 Ссылка Дата регистрации на форуме: 18 июля 2015 |
uav1606 написал: Опечатался. 168. Исправил. А почему 198, а не 168? uav1606 написал: Да, один. Я так понял, канал (разъём) IDE на этом компьютере один? Не считая звуковушки? uav1606 написал: Спасибо, попробую завтра, пора спать. Можете попробовать такие комбинации: |
<<Назад Вперед>> | Страницы: 1 2 * 3 4 | Печать |
Полигон-2 » IBM PC-совместимое. До 2000 года включительно » Разъёмы IDE на звуковых картах |
1 посетитель просмотрел эту тему за последние 15 минут |
В том числе: 1 гость, 0 скрытых пользователей |
Последние | |
[Москва] LIQUID-Акция. Сливаются разъемы CF МС7004 и 7004А на AT и XT Пайка термотрубок Проммать s478 PEAK 715VL2-HT ( Full-Size SBC) Подскажите по 386 материке по джамперам. |
Самые активные 5 тем | |